学位论文 > 优秀研究生学位论文题录展示
嵌入式控制系统故障的灰关联分析及诊断专家系统开发平台
作 者: 王兆耀
导 师: 凌志浩
学 校: 华东理工大学
专 业: 控制科学与工程
关键词: 故障诊断 灰关联分析 专家系统 开发平台 嵌入式系统
分类号: TP273.5
类 型: 硕士论文
年 份: 2011年
下 载: 84次
引 用: 0次
阅 读: 论文下载
内容摘要
目前,嵌入式系统在控制设备中被广泛使用且具有专用性强的特点。针对某一具体的控制设备,开发出满足要求的故障诊断专家系统需要很长时间。因此,以专家系统为基础,以快速开发的理念,运用跨平台的代码生成技术,研究和设计一套针对嵌入式控制系统的故障诊断专家系统开发平台,可以有效地提高诊断专家系统的开发效率,提高控制系统的运行效率、可靠性。本文针对当前嵌入式控制系统所需的故障诊断要求,提出了基于灰关联分析算法和专家系统的分层故障诊断设计方案。在此方案的基础上,针对专家系统开发平台的需求,围绕着专家系统的组成模块,设计了用于嵌入式控制系统故障诊断的专家系统开发平台软件的构建框架,并对开发平台的框架进行了功能模块的划分。通过对开发平台的数据、规则表示和推理机制的深入研究,按照模块设计的思想,实现专家系统开发平台软件的数据库、知识库、推理机和代码生成等模块。开发平台软件采用XML和XSLT代码生成技术,并对生成专家系统代码进行了整体规划,实现了代码的分层结构,降低了代码的内聚和耦合,提高了代码的健壮性和安全性。最后,以电梯控制系统为背景,通过对其模拟系统的应用实验及其所得的诊断结果,验证了其平台所生成的专家系统诊断的准确性和有效性,说明了结合灰关联分析算法的诊断专家系统开发平台软件的可行性。
|
全文目录
摘要 5-6 Abstract 6-10 第1章 绪论 10-18 1.1 课题研究背景及其意义 10-11 1.2 故障诊断专家系统 11-14 1.2.1 控制系统故障诊断概述 11-12 1.2.2 专家系统概述 12-13 1.2.3 故障诊断专家系统原理 13 1.2.4 故障诊断专家系统发展 13-14 1.3 嵌入式系统软件开发平台 14-16 1.3.1 开发平台概念 14-15 1.3.2 专家系统开发平台 15-16 1.4 本文研究内容及组成 16-18 第2章 灰关联分析及故障诊断方案的构建 18-26 2.1 灰色系统理论概述 18 2.2 灰关联分析理论 18-23 2.2.1 数据变换 18-19 2.2.2 灰关联分析的基本概念 19-22 2.2.3 基于灰关联分析的故障诊断 22-23 2.3 灰关联分析的局限性 23-24 2.4 分层的故障诊断架构 24-25 2.5 小结 25-26 第3章 分层故障诊断专家系统开发平台框架及模块 26-36 3.1 分层专家系统开发平台开发的流程 26-27 3.1.1 软件设计生命周期 26 3.1.2 开发平台需求分析 26-27 3.2 开发平台框架 27-29 3.2.1 分层故障诊断专家系统的组成 27-28 3.2.2 开发平台框架的组成 28-29 3.3 分层专家系统数据库 29-30 3.3.1 数据库抽象 29 3.3.2 灰关联分析处理数据 29-30 3.4 分层专家系统知识库 30-32 3.4.1 故障库的抽象 30-31 3.4.2 灰关联分析故障处理方法 31-32 3.4.3 知识的获取与表示方法 32 3.5 专家系统推理机 32-34 3.5.1 常用推理方式 32-33 3.5.2 Rete推理方式 33-34 3.6 开发工具链 34 3.7 小结 34-36 第4章 故障诊断专家系统开发平台的实现 36-57 4.1 开发平台登录管理 36-38 4.1.1 用户登录认证 36 4.1.2 用户管理 36-37 4.1.3 用户授权数据库配置 37-38 4.2 专家系统人机界面 38-40 4.2.1 人机界面的菜单及功能 38 4.2.2 人机界面的组成 38-40 4.3 专家系统数据库 40-48 4.3.1 上位机数据库搭建 41-43 4.3.2 下位机数据库搭建 43-45 4.3.3 灰关联分析时序数据输入方式 45-48 4.4 专家系统知识库 48-51 4.4.1 知识库的搭建 48-49 4.4.2 专家系统知识输入方式 49-51 4.5 专家系统推理机 51-52 4.5.1 数据状态获取方法 51-52 4.5.2 Rete推理方法 52 4.6 专家系统代码生成 52-55 4.6.1 XML及XSLT技术介绍 52-53 4.6.2 专家系统代码生成 53-55 4.7 应用软件模块 55-56 4.8 小结 56-57 第5章 开发平台模拟实验环境的构建和测试 57-66 5.1 嵌入式硬件实验平台 57 5.2 Modbus通信的实现 57-60 5.2.1 Modbus协议简介 57-58 5.2.2 Modbus协议的实现 58-60 5.3 模拟实验环境架构 60-61 5.3.1 辅助处理器架构 60 5.3.2 共享处理器的架构 60-61 5.4 灰关联分析算法测试 61-63 5.4.1 测试数据 61-62 5.4.2 测试方法及结果 62-63 5.5 电梯模拟实验环境测试 63-65 5.5.1 电梯常见故障及规则 63-64 5.5.2 电梯控制器测试 64-65 5.6 小结 65-66 第6章 结论与展望 66-68 6.1 本课题工作总结 66 6.2 工作展望 66-68 参考文献 68-72 致谢 72-73 在读期间参加的科研工作及发表的学术论文 73 科研工作 73 学术论文 73
|
相似论文
- 基于WinCE平台的故障分析仪应用程序设计与开发,TP311.52
- 汽车的电动助力转向系统,U463.4
- 基于PCA-SVM的液体火箭发动机试验台故障诊断算法研究,V433.9
- 基于ARM9的Windows CE系统移植,TP316.7
- 基于嵌入式图像处理单元的运动目标跟踪系统研究,TP391.41
- 面向嵌入式超声检测系统的图形接口设计与应用,TP274.53
- 多线阵CCD视觉测量系统的数据采集与处理,TP274.2
- LXI-VXI适配器研制,TP274
- 基于支持向量机的故障诊断方法研究,TP18
- 三容水箱系统故障诊断算法研究,TP277
- 高性能恒温晶体振荡器温度控制系统的研究,TN752
- 嵌入式中医经脉理疗仪的研究,R197.39
- 我国进境植物检疫专家系统开发,S41-30
- 基于嵌入式系统钻孔成像装置的研究,P634.3
- IPsec VPN嵌入式硬件防火墙加密卡的应用研究,TP393.08
- 混凝土泵液压系统故障诊断方法研究,TU646
- 基于WEB的GPS监控系统设计与实现,TP311.52
- 以太网MAC层协议研究与FPGA实现,TP393.04
- 基于数据融合技术舞台故障诊断方法的研究,TP18
- 安全策略的形式化描述及其可视化实现,TP309.1
- 基于GPRS的变压器故障诊断系统的研究,TM407
中图分类: > 工业技术 > 自动化技术、计算机技术 > 自动化技术及设备 > 自动化系统 > 自动控制、自动控制系统 > 计算机控制、计算机控制系统
© 2012 www.xueweilunwen.com
|